TORTWORTH Court Hotel has changed hands.

The hotel, opened by the Four Pillars group seven years ago following a £20million restoration of the neglected, fire-damaged Victorian mansion, has been bought by a New York-based property investment company.

It is one of five Four Pillars hotels in Oxfordshire and Gloucestershire to be acquired by RREEF Real Estate - part of Deutsche Bank - which buys and manages property all over the world.

The new owners say the hotels wil continue operating as usual and there are no implications for the group's more than 500-strong workforce.

Under the deal Four Pillars founding director Brian Murtagh and current chief executive Charles Holmes will retain shares in the hotel operation and there will be a joint venture to expand the business.

Planning consent has been granted for the venture's first new hotel in Harwell, Oxfordshire, and other sites are also in the pipeline.

A RREEF spookesman said: "As far as customers and staff of the existing hotels are concerned - including Tortworth Court - nothing is going to change. The fact that the founders of Four Pillars are continuing their involvement is indicative of a positive outlook for the hotels business."

Alistair Dixon, chief executive of opportunity funds at RREEF said: "We're delighted to be taking our first steps into this segment of the UK hospitality market sector through an investment that will take advantage of the UK's steady economic growth.

"Through our partnership with the Four Pillars management team, we have created a solid platform for future investment and intend to build a substantial portfolio over the coming years."

The Four Pillars group currently owns three and four star hotels with conference, banqueting and leisure facilities and has recently opened a 220 bedroom conference and spa hotel in the Cotswold Water Park near Cirencester.
